Govt to contract 6,000 teachers

PADANG, West Sumatra: Minister of Education and Culture Wardiman Djojonegoro said his office would soon contract 6,000 teachers to overcome the current shortage of teachers across the country.

He said in Padang Panjang on Saturday that if the plan worked well in the initial stage, it would be followed by further stages to gradually address the shortage of teachers.

The teachers will be posted evenly throughout all provinces with the exception of Jakarta where the teacher shortage problem is not very serious. Wardiman did not elaborate on the extent of the teacher shortage.

Experts have said the problem is not a shortage of teachers but the poor posting distribution. There are areas with a surplus of teachers and others with only a handful.

The teacher contract system is expected to help reduce unemployment among the 8.6 million job seekers in the country, Wardiman was quoted by Antara as saying. (swe)
